In-depth review: Summarify
Summarify positions itself as a budget-friendly, multi-format AI summarizer that aims to be a one-stop shop for condensing text, web pages, PDFs, YouTube videos, and audio files across 19+ languages. Its core appeal lies in breadth and simplicity: a single tool that can handle diverse content types without requiring a credit card for the free trial. But as with many freemium tools, the gap between promise and practical utility is defined by hard limits. The free tier offers only five summaries per month, with PDFs capped at five pages and videos or audio at ten minutes—enough for a quick test drive, but insufficient for any regular workflow. Paid plans start at $62 per year for 100 summaries per month, scaling up to $116 per year for 1,000 summaries and higher per-file limits (e.g., 100-page PDFs, 120-minute videos). Notably, there is no monthly subscription option, which may deter users who prefer flexibility. Where Summarify stands out is in its language support: summarizing content in over 19 languages is a genuine differentiator for multilingual users, though the quality of non-English summaries may vary. The tool is best suited for light, occasional use—students skimming short articles, researchers digesting a few PDFs, or content creators repurposing brief video clips. However, for heavy users or those needing nuanced control over summary length or tone, Summarify's lack of customization options becomes a limitation. The AI produces fixed-length summaries without adjustable parameters, which can miss the mark for detailed analytical work. In practice, the tool fits into a quick-scan workflow: paste a URL, upload a file, or drop a YouTube link, and receive a condensed version in seconds. The interface is clean and straightforward, reducing friction for first-time users. Yet, the annual-only pricing model and relatively modest per-file limits suggest that Summarify is designed for individuals with low-to-moderate summarization needs, not power users. For journalists or researchers who need to process dozens of sources daily, the Pro plan's 1,000 summaries per month might suffice, but the 120-minute video cap could still be restrictive for long-form content like webinars or lectures. Ultimately, Summarify is a competent entry-level tool that delivers on its promise of multi-format summarization, but its value hinges on whether your content volume and file sizes align with its tiered constraints. The free trial is generous enough to test core functionality, but upgrading requires a year-long commitment. For those who prioritize breadth, language variety, and simplicity over depth and customization, Summarify is a solid choice. Others may find better value in tools that offer monthly billing, adjustable summary lengths, or higher per-file limits.

Pricing
Parsed from stored tiers (HTML or plain text). If a line is missing, check the notes below — confirm on the vendor site before purchasing.
Trial
$0/ month
Free 5 Summaries Per Month, All File Types Supported, PDFs (Upto 5 pages), Youtube Video (Upto 10 mins), Audio File (Upto 10 mins)
Basic
$62/ year
$62 /year(Save10%) 100 Summaries Per Month, All File Types Supported, PDFs (Upto 20 pages), Youtube Video (Upto 30 mins), Audio File (Upto 30 mins), Priority Support
Pro
$116/ year
$116 /year(Save10%) 1000 Summaries Per Month, All File Types Supported, PDFs (Upto 100 pages), Youtube Video (Upto 120 mins), Audio File (Upto 120 mins), Priority Support
Standard
$89/ year
$89 /year(Save10%) 500 Summaries Per Month, All File Types Supported, PDFs (Upto 50 pages), Youtube Video (Upto 60 mins), Audio File (Upto 60 mins), Priority Support

Frequently asked questions
What is the difference between Summarify's free trial and paid plans?Pricing
The free trial offers 5 summaries per month with limits: PDFs up to 5 pages, YouTube/audio up to 10 minutes. Paid plans start at $62/year (Basic) for 100 summaries per month, with higher limits on pages and duration, plus priority support.
Can Summarify summarize very long PDFs or videos?Limitations
Yes, but with limits. The free trial supports PDFs up to 5 pages and videos/audio up to 10 minutes. Paid plans increase limits: Basic (20 pages, 30 mins), Standard (50 pages, 60 mins), Pro (100 pages, 120 mins). For content exceeding these limits, you may need to split the file or upgrade.
Does Summarify support languages other than English?General
Yes, Summarify supports summarization in 19+ languages, including Spanish, French, German, and more. However, the quality of summaries may vary depending on the language and complexity of the content.
How accurate are the summaries compared to reading the original?Workflow
Summarify's AI generally captures main points well, but accuracy depends on content complexity and language. For straightforward articles or clear audio, summaries are reliable. For nuanced or highly technical content, some details may be missed, so it's best used as a starting point.
Is there a monthly payment option or only annual?Pricing
Summarify only offers annual plans. There is no monthly billing option. However, you can use the coupon code NEW10 to get 10% off on all annual plans.
Can I use Summarify to summarize audio files from my phone?Workflow
Yes, you can upload audio files from your phone via the Summarify website. The tool supports common audio formats. However, the free trial limits audio length to 10 minutes, and transcription accuracy depends on audio quality.
